    I have mets to two ribs - 10th left anterior, 6th right posterior. I've never had any pain I can attribute to those mets. Lately I've had excruciating, sharp pain on the left side when I move certain ways or lay on that side - but it doesn't appear to be caused by mets but rather muscle/nerve pain from the UMX and/or DIEP.

    If you're concerned about bone mets and can't seem to pinpoint a reason for your pain, you could request a bone scan. That's how my mets were discovered, and now how I watch for progression. Pain isn't always an indication of mets, but if does mean something's going on. Good luck!

    Randi, it really doesn't sound like rib mets to me. Perhaps it is sore from too much coughing? I have a few rib mets and I can stick my finger on the exact spots, so my pain is very focused. Some people don't know they have them until they show up on a scan. We are all different though, so it is good that you are being checked. Good luck.

    Randi64, I had excrutiating pain in my right side and it was discovered 2 months later that I had 2 fractured/healing ribs on that side. Then I had a bone density test and was found to have osteoporosis. I'm told that this can cause ribs to fracture with even a cough. So I would suggest requesting x-rays to check for broken ribs.
